Reporting to the Head of S2P Delivery, the Vendor Master Data Management Analyst plays a critical role in driving the effective management and governance of vendor master data ensuring data accuracy, compliance, and efficiency within the source-to-pay process.

Responsibilities

  • Data Governance: Following the Core model, maintain robust processes for the governance and integrity of vendor master data.

  • Data Quality Management: Monitor and enhance data quality, ensuring accurate and up-to-date information in the vendor master database.

  • Vendor Onboarding & Modification: Collaborate with business and procurement teams to facilitate the onboarding & modification of new vendors, ensuring completeness and accuracy of data. Ensure awareness of Business functions of processes for Vendor Creation/modification.

  • Compliance: Enforce compliance with data standards, policies, and regulations related to vendor master data management.

  • Continuous Improvement: Identify opportunities for process optimization, automation, and efficiency gains in vendor master data management and feedback to Business process owner.

  • Reporting: Generate regular reports on the status and quality of vendor master data, providing insights to relevant stakeholders.

  • Issue Resolution: Investigate and resolve vendor creation/modification and vendor data-related issues, collaborating with cross-functional teams to address root causes.

  • Stakeholder Collaboration: Work closely with procurement, finance, and IT teams to ensure alignment to Core vendor master data processes and broader organizational objectives.
